Rapide de nuit
Originally released in 1948. Rapide de nuit is a drama film. directed by Marcel Blistène. At just 80 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Roger Pigaut, Sophie Desmarets, and Michel Ardan
Synopsis
Duped by a pretty woman who uses him to smuggle a suitcase containing the proceeds of a theft through the station, an honest fellow understands everything and replaces the suitcase with a similar one. The police do not understand anything, but the pretty girl promises to become honest like the one who almost was her pigeon.
